DISCUSSION:

Welfare and Institutions (W&I) Code section 5150 provides authority for the Board of Supervisors to designate eligible professionals who can initiate and discontinue 72 hour holds for evaluation and treatment of individuals who, as a result of a mental health disorder, are considered a danger to themselves, others, or are gravely disabled. In addition to the persons listed in W&I Code section 5150, on September 15, 2015 (item C-10), your board authorized certain eligible professional persons to initiate and discontinue those holds in Resolution No. 15-101.

 

The County Behavioral Health Director is authorized to develop procedures for the county’s designation and training of professionals who will be designated to perform functions under W&I Code section 5150 including an application and approval process, initial and ongoing training and testing requirements, and monitoring and reviewing to ensure appropriate compliance with state law, regulations, and county procedures. County Behavioral Health , per this authorizations, has produced policies and procedures as well as training protocols to be used.

 

This Resolution adds the following persons to be designated to initiate and discontinue a W&I Code section 5150 hold:

 

1.                     Licensed Professional Clinical Counselors;

2.                     Board of Behavioral Science Examiners (BBSE) Registered:

a.                     Associate Clinical Social Workers;

b.                     Associate Marriage and Family Therapists; and

c.                     Associate Professional Clinical Counselors
